Daniele Procida: Diátaxis Documentation Framework
Apply Procida's Diátaxis framework for creating documentation that serves its readers.
Core Philosophy
"Documentation needs to include and be structured around its four different functions: tutorials, how-to guides, technical reference, and explanation."
The Problem Diátaxis Solves
Documentation fails when it mixes purposes. A reference doc that tries to teach, or a tutorial that tries to explain everything, serves no one well.

The Four Types
1. Tutorials (Learning-Oriented)
Purpose: Take a beginner through a series of steps to complete a meaningful project.
Characteristics:
- •Focused on learning, not accomplishment
- •Learning by doing
- •The reader should feel successful at each step
- •No unnecessary explanation (save it for Explanation docs)
- •Hold the reader's hand completely
Structure:

Anti-patterns:
- •Offering choices ("you could do X or Y")
- •Explaining theory while teaching
- •Assuming knowledge
- •Skipping steps
2. How-To Guides (Task-Oriented)
Purpose: Show how to accomplish a specific task.
Characteristics:
- •Focused on achieving a goal
- •Assumes competence
- •Addresses a specific problem
- •No teaching (that's for tutorials)
- •No explaining (that's for explanation)
Structure:

Anti-patterns:
- •Teaching while guiding
- •Excessive explanation
- •Being too restrictive about how to accomplish the goal
3. Reference (Information-Oriented)
Purpose: Describe the machinery - accurate, complete, austere.
Characteristics:
- •Structured by the code, not by tasks
- •Consistent format throughout
- •Accurate and up-to-date
- •No teaching, no how-to
- •Like a dictionary: look up what you need
Structure:

Anti-patterns:
- •Including steps (that's how-to)
- •Being too brief
- •Avoiding opinions and judgment

Placement Guidelines
| Type | Location | Examples |
|---|---|---|
| Tutorial | docs/tutorials/ | Getting started, build-your-first |
| How-To | docs/how-to/ or README sections | Configuration, deployment, migration |
| Reference | docs/api/, inline (JSDoc/JavaDoc) | API docs, config options |
| Explanation | docs/architecture/, docs/concepts/ | Design docs, ADRs |
Quality Checklist
Tutorials
- • Complete beginner can follow without prior knowledge
- • Every step is explicit with no choices
- • Reader accomplishes something meaningful
- • Minimal explanation (just enough to proceed)
- • Tests work at each checkpoint
How-To
- • Solves a specific, real problem
- • Assumes competence (no teaching)
- • Steps are numbered and clear
- • Includes troubleshooting for common issues
- • No extraneous explanation
Reference
- • Complete - nothing missing
- • Consistent format throughout
- • Accurate to current implementation
- • Includes examples for every item
- • Organized by the structure of the code
Explanation
- • Provides genuine insight
- • Discusses alternatives and trade-offs
- • Connects to bigger picture
- • Takes a position (not wishy-washy)
- • Links to relevant how-tos and reference
Common Mistakes
Mixing Types
Wrong:
# Authentication API The authenticate() method logs users in. To use it, first install the package (npm install auth), then import it... [mixing reference with tutorial]
Right: Separate reference from tutorial, link between them.
Tutorial That Teaches Theory
Wrong:
Step 3: Now we'll use dependency injection. Dependency injection is a pattern where dependencies are provided to a class rather than created by it... [teaching in a tutorial]
Right: Save explanation for explanation docs. In tutorial, just do it.
